名词 n.
  1. A means of escape.
  2. The effecting of an escape.

  3. A vacation or holiday, or the destination for one. informal
形容词 adj.
  1. Pertaining to an escape, as in a vehicle or plans. not-comparable
    — They'd been discussing their getaway plans for weeks.
